Definition
An area of medicine within the subspecialty of cardiology, which uses specialized imaging and other diagnostic techniques to evaluate blood flow and pressure in the coronary arteries and chambers of the heart and uses technical procedures and medications to treat abnormalities that impair the function of the cardiovascular system.

Injection, inclisiran, 1 mg J1306
Inclisiran is an injection administered to lower cholesterol levels. It works by blocking the production of LDL (bad cholesterol) in your liver. This medicine is often used when diet changes and other medications have not been effective.

Routine electrocardiogram (ecg) using at least 12 leads with interpretation and report 93000
An electrocardiogram (ECG) is a non-invasive test that records your heart's electrical activity. Using 12 leads attached to your body, it captures data to help identify heart conditions. A doctor interprets the results and provides a report.
